Output 526222351c51b7c38fabcd024f9d9ef61e54e1440caa69d36849a2289734dcee:26

value
4346039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86bc15ddb12d00721a4a11c7c2bbab9d418bc399 OP_EQUAL
address
3DyRneowA13r6QfMvD6P8VhTMWM15i1jQM
transaction
526222351c51b7c38fabcd024f9d9ef61e54e1440caa69d36849a2289734dcee